JWC: Refs for Final day

Thu, 18 Jun 2009 14:50

The IRB has announced the appointment of referees for the Final day, including the championship Final which will refereed by James Jones of Wales.

The match between Uruguay and Japan is also a vital one as it will determine who is relegated to the Junior World Trophy.

The principle of neutrality applied to appointments which rules out Keith Brown, Chris Pollock and Andrew Small for the final.

Final Day Match Officials

15/16: Uruguay vs Japan 
Referee: James Bolabiu (Fiji)
Assistant referees: Javier Mancuso (Argentina), Tako Otsuki (Japan)

13/14: Canada vs Italy in Nagoya 
Referee: Taizo Hirabayashi (Japan)
Assistant referees: Javier Mancuso (Argentina), Tako Otsuki (Japan) 

11/12: Argentina vs Fiji in Osaka 
Referee: Carlo Damasco (Italy)
Assistant referees: Chris Pollock (New Zealand), Tetsuhiko Kawano (Japan) 

9/10: Tonga vs Scotland in Osaka 
Referee: Ian Smith (Australia)
Assistant referees: Chris Pollock (New Zealand), Tetsuhiko Kawano (Japan) 

7/8: Ireland vs Samoa in Fukuoka 
Referee: Pascal Gauzere (France) 
Assistant referees: Andrew Small (England), Akihisa Aso (Japan) 

5/6 Wales vs France in Fukuoka 
Referee: James Leckie (Australia) 
Assistant referees: Andrew Small (England), Akihisa Aso (Japan) 

3/4: Australia vs South Africa in Tokyo
Referee: Keith Brown (New Zealand) 
Assistant referees: Peter Allan (Scotland), Jérôme Garces (France)

1/2: New Zealand vs England in Tokyo 
Referee: James Jones (Wales)
Assistant referees: Peter Allan (Scotland), Jérôme Garces (France)
